Family history events

All events are held in the Auckland Research Centre located on level two of the Central City Library.

 

May

Papers past – New Zealand online Newspapers

Wednesday 14 May - noon to 1pm

Discover how to get the most out of the newspaper titles available on this free to view website created by national Library of New Zealand.  Free entry.  Bookings are required.

 

Using the Auckland City Libraries online catalogue

Wednesday 28 May - noon to 1pm

A course to help you make best use of the huge resources available online.

Free entry. Bookings are required.

 

 

June

New Zealand electoral rolls

Wednesday 11 June - noon to 1pm

Electoral rolls in New Zealand: who could vote, important dates, electorates and their boundaries, supplementary rolls. Why this is an important resource for family history research.

Free entry.  Bookings are required.

 

Photos for family history

Wednesday 25 June - noon to 1pm

Making the most of Heritage images on line and the photograph collection at Auckland City Libraries

Free entry. Bookings are required.
